exasperate:

to irritate intensely or frustrate

(Verb)

Example Sentences:

Ramayana:  When none of the demons could even budge Angada’s foot, Ravana felt exasperated.

Mahabharata:  When Duryodhana’s actions implied that Bhishma was fighting half-heartedly because of his affection for the Pandavas, Bhishma felt exasperated.

Bhagavad-gita:  When we feel exasperated in our attempts to enjoy worldly pleasures, then we may become receptive to exploring life’s spiritual side.
